Senate Bill 171: A Bill Raising the Compulsory Attendance Age

Authors:
Senators Linda Garrou, Peter Samuel (Pete) Brunstetter, Jim Jacumin, Ed Jones, Tony Rand, and John Snow

Summary:
This bill would raise the compulsory attendance age from 16 to 17, until the child graduates from high school. HSLDA opposes any expansion of state control over education

Status:
2/13/2007 Introduced
2/14/2007 Referred to the Senate Education Committee
5/9/2007 Committee report favorable and re-referred to the Appropriations Committee

HSLDA's Position:
HSLDA opposes this legislation.
